Jon and Garfield visit the United Kingdom, where a case of mistaken cat identity finds Garfield ruling over a castle. His reign is soon jeopardized by the nefarious Lord Dargis, who has designs on the estate.
2024
2019
1979
2021
2017
2014
2015
2018
1933
1946
1967
2025
2006
1937
2004
1997
1964
2010